Air strikes which killed at least 16 people, including seven children, in Yemen's Dalea province blamed on Saudi coalition – local officials
In this file phote, Red Crescent medics stand at the site of Saudi-led air strikes on a Houthi detention centre in Dhamar, Yemen. September 1, 2019.
"Sixteen people, including women and children, were killed and nine others injured" in a coalition air raid targeting a residence in Daleh province, a local official told AFP news agency on condition of anonymity.
